Commit d0c21c4b authored by Mac's avatar Mac

1

parent 71021c4c
...@@ -19,18 +19,18 @@ ...@@ -19,18 +19,18 @@
</el-option> </el-option>
</el-select> </el-select>
</el-form-item> </el-form-item>
<el-form-item label="是否为公开课"> <el-form-item label="是否为公开课" >
<el-radio v-model="addMsg.IsPublic" :label="0"></el-radio> <el-radio v-model="addMsg.IsPublic" :label="0" @change="getgongkai()"></el-radio>
<el-radio v-model="addMsg.IsPublic" :label="1"></el-radio> <el-radio v-model="addMsg.IsPublic" :label="1" @change="getgongkai()"></el-radio>
</el-form-item> </el-form-item>
<el-form-item label="是否免费"> <el-form-item label="是否免费">
<el-radio v-model="addMsg.IsFree" :label="0"></el-radio> <el-radio v-model="addMsg.IsFree" :label="0" :disabled="gkshow"></el-radio>
<el-radio v-model="addMsg.IsFree" :label="1"></el-radio> <el-radio v-model="addMsg.IsFree" :label="1" :disabled="gkshow"></el-radio>
</el-form-item> </el-form-item>
<el-form-item label="点数" prop="PointNum" class="is-required" size="small"> <el-form-item label="点数" prop="PointNum" class="is-required" size="small">
<el-input v-model="addMsg.PointNum" placeholder="请输入点数" class="w400" type="number" :min="0"/> <el-input v-model="addMsg.PointNum" placeholder="请输入点数" class="w400" type="number" :min="0" :disabled="gkshow"/>
</el-form-item> </el-form-item>
<el-form-item label="时长" prop="Duration" class="is-required" size="small"> <el-form-item label="时长" prop="Duration" class="is-required" size="small">
<el-input v-model="addMsg.Duration" placeholder="请输入时长" class="w400" type="number" :min="0"/> <el-input v-model="addMsg.Duration" placeholder="请输入时长" class="w400" type="number" :min="0"/>
...@@ -101,6 +101,7 @@ ...@@ -101,6 +101,7 @@
CourseClassList:[], CourseClassList:[],
DurationList:[], DurationList:[],
StudentList:[], StudentList:[],
gkshow:false
}; };
}, },
created() { created() {
...@@ -113,6 +114,16 @@ ...@@ -113,6 +114,16 @@
this.getStudentList()//上课人数枚举 this.getStudentList()//上课人数枚举
}, },
methods: { methods: {
getgongkai(){
if(this.addMsg.IsPublic == 1){
this.addMsg.PointNum =0;
this.addMsg.IsFree =1;
this.gkshow = true;
}else {
this.gkshow = false
}
},
Save(formName) { Save(formName) {
this.$refs[formName].validate((valid) => { this.$refs[formName].validate((valid) => {
if (valid) { if (valid) {
......
This diff is collapsed.
...@@ -202,6 +202,9 @@ ...@@ -202,6 +202,9 @@
<li class="menu_item" :class="{'Fchecked':isChecked=='/onlineclassifyList'}" @click="isChecked='/onlineclassifyList',CommonJump('onlineclassifyList')"> <li class="menu_item" :class="{'Fchecked':isChecked=='/onlineclassifyList'}" @click="isChecked='/onlineclassifyList',CommonJump('onlineclassifyList')">
<i class="el-icon-menu"></i><span>在线分类列表</span> <i class="el-icon-menu"></i><span>在线分类列表</span>
</li> </li>
<li class="menu_item" :class="{'Fchecked':isChecked=='/teacherCourseList'}" @click="isChecked='/teacherCourseList',CommonJump('teacherCourseList')">
<i class="el-icon-menu"></i><span>老师排课</span>
</li>
</ul> </ul>
</div> </div>
</div> </div>
......
This diff is collapsed.
...@@ -409,6 +409,18 @@ export default new Router({ ...@@ -409,6 +409,18 @@ export default new Router({
path: '/addclassify', path: '/addclassify',
name: 'addclassify', name: 'addclassify',
component: resolve => require(['@/components/education/addclassify'], resolve), component: resolve => require(['@/components/education/addclassify'], resolve),
},
//网课 老师排课
{
path: '/teacherCourseList',
name: 'teacherCourseList',
component: resolve => require(['@/components/education/teacherCourseList'], resolve),
},
//网课 新增/修改老师排课
{
path: '/addteacherCourse',
name: 'addteacherCourse',
component: resolve => require(['@/components/education/addteacherCourse'], resolve),
} }
] ]
}, },
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ment